How to Get a Spare Honda Key
You will always need a spare Honda key in case you are in an emergency. This will help you arrive at your destination swiftly.
Reparing a key fob
You'll need the appropriate tools, whether you're buying an all-new car or fixing a Honda key fob. Certain key fobs require special tools, like jeweler's screwdrivers. If you don't own these items at hand, you might require locksmiths to assist you. You can also find details on how to replace a key fob on YouTube.
Before you purchase a replacement key, examine the warranty coverage for your car. If you're covered under bumper-to-bumper warranties it could be possible to have the key fob replaced free. If you don't have insurance, you might require the replacement. You can also buy replacement batteries online or in the hardware store. If you choose to go this route make sure you consider that the cost of the battery can be quite high. However, you can save money on labor costs by replacing the battery yourself.
Your Honda key fob has batteries to provide power to it. It's usually a round 3-volt battery. You can replace the battery yourself or have it replaced by an honda spare key replacement dealer. A screwdriver is necessary if you're looking to replace the battery.
Online ordering of replacement key fob batteries is also possible. However, the batteries might differ from model to. If you're unsure, consult your owner's manual. If you don't have one then your Honda dealer will provide instructions on how to change a honda jazz remote key not working key fob. Certain models are soldered to the battery, while others can be removed easily. If you're not sure how to change the battery in your car, you might want to consider hiring locksmith.
If you wish to replace the battery yourself you will need to take the key fob from the. Certain models can be opened with an ordinary screwdriver or coin. For greater precision, you might require a flat-head screwdriver. Some models are soldered onto the circuit board, so you'll need to join the battery to the board. You can also purchase a key fob with a battery already installed.
To rebuild your key fob ensure that the buttons are aligned with the back. The buttons might fall out in the event that you don't. You can also buy replacement buttons. You can change your key fob quickly by purchasing replaceable buttons. You may even be able to re-program your remote before you buy a new one.
After you've put the key back together fob, you'll need an additional battery. You can buy a new one from the internet or at your local Honda dealer. It is a good idea keep a spare key in your car. This is particularly crucial if you own an older vehicle. If you lose your key, you might have to call roadside assistance.
Programming an alternative key
Utilizing a transponder chip programer to program a Honda key is a good way to save time and money. A transponder chips is a small programable chip that's embedded into the key of your Honda Accord. It alerts the car that the key is about to be turned on. Typically the key will be lit for about three seconds after it has been programmed.
The key fob on a honda accord car key Accord is typically a small, silver-colored, battery-powered piece with a circular design. The battery is typically around one year. You can replace the battery in the event that it fails.
Before you start, it's important to find the VIN (vehicle identification) number on your car. It's usually on the right side of the dashboard. You can also find this number in the owner's manual. You can also search online for the number in case it's not on the vehicle.
Once you have your VIN number, you'll have to program your key. You can do this at home or take your car to an auto dealer. A transponder programer is a must if you plan to program more than one key simultaneously. It's relatively inexpensive and can program up to 48 distinct automobile brands.
Without the need to visit the dealer the transponder chip programer can help you program your Honda key. Although it may seem daunting however, the process isn't hard at all. It's easy to use the device. First, you will require a programr that is compatible with the model of your car and then insert the key into it.
A Honda model with a modern key fob is likely to contain a small transponder chip. It is a tiny programmable chip that allows the key to be synchronized to the engine. The key must be programmed to start the engine. It won't start the engine until the key is actually put into the ignition.
You can also program your Honda key to ensure you have a valid one. You can use the key to start your car in the event that you lose it. You can also purchase keys online for less than $50.
You'll also require access to the ignition switch. If you are concerned about losing your key you may want to consider buying a transponder programming device. It can be purchased on the internet for a bargain price and can program a variety of keys.
If you're considering programming the Honda key, you might need to contact your dealer for if they can help you. They may be able to help you find a locksmith in case they don't offer this service. Many locksmiths are knowledgeable and are able to program your keys for you, or they can cut keys for you.
Getting a replacement car key honda key
Although it can seem overwhelming to replace your Honda key, it's actually quite easy. It is important to find a locksmith or dealer that has the appropriate technology. This will ensure that the new key works with your vehicle.
The dealership can program a smart key. It is a technologically advanced device that opens doors and opens the trunk. It works by sending radio waves to communicate with your vehicle. This is a great way of preventing theft, however it can be costly. A smartkey or keyless entry remote can cost as much as $450. This cost can vary based on the type of key you pick.
Smart keys function by using a special chip that transmits a unique code that your car recognizes. The key could also be equipped with a unique "immobilizer" anti-theft function which can make it more difficult to steal. Modern keys are also equipped with an electronic key fob which allows remote unlocking of trunks and doors. This type of key can also be programmed at home.
You'll need to schedule an appointment with the dealer if are interested in a smartkey for Honda. You'll also need proof of ownership and have the vehicle transported to the dealership. Some insurance companies do not cover the cost of towing. It is likely that your vehicle will require inspection. This can increase the cost.
It is also necessary to provide the VIN number of your car and title certificate. Some models will include the tag with an identifier barcode and the car number. It's usually a tiny piece of plastic. It could also be a metal label.
There are a variety of reasons the car keys will not function. The most common reason your keys don't work is that the battery is dead. The battery must be replaced. If you are unable to locate a battery, you could need to change the ignition cylinder. It is also possible to re-programme your key fob.
If you've lost your Honda key, the key number tag can be located by making contact with your Honda dealer. It's usually a small piece of metal that displays numbers. The number tag on the door jamb, inside the trunk, or on the key. Not all locksmiths and dealers have the capability of cutting number tags.
You can also create an exact copy of your key at home. If you don't have a key fob you can cut a traditional key at an hardware store. The hardware store will typically charge between $10 to $25 for cutting. However, not all stores have the latest technology. If you're looking for a more economical alternative, you might prefer the possibility of selling keys through a third party. Many third-party sellers provide keys in blank format at a lower cost.
